Understanding Weight Loss

Weight loss fundamentally revolves around the concept of energy balance: consuming fewer calories than your body expends. This can be achieved by adjusting both dietary habits and physical activity levels.

Establishing Realistic Goals

Setting achievable goals is vital to maintaining motivation and fostering a positive mindset throughout your weight loss journey. Consider the following approaches:

  • Focus on gradual weight loss, aiming for 1-2 pounds per week.
  • Set process-oriented goals, such as committing to exercise regularly or tracking food intake, rather than solely on the outcome.
  • Recognize that setbacks may occur; view them as learning opportunities rather than failures.

Nutrition: Fueling Your Journey

Your dietary choices play a pivotal role in your weight loss journey. Here are some practical steps to consider:

  • Choose whole, unprocessed foods such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ins.
  • Monitor portion sizes to avoid overeating.
  • Stay hydrated; sometimes, thirst is mistaken for hunger.
  • Plan meals ahead of time to mitigate impulsive eating.

When to Consult a Professional

While embarking on a weight loss journey, it is essential to recognize when professional guidance is needed. Seek advice from a healthcare provider or registered dietitian if:

  • You have underlying health conditions that may affect your weight loss.
  • You experience drastic changes in weight without effort.
  • You have concerns about nutritional adequacy or disordered eating patterns.
  • You require personalized support to navigate weight loss challenges.

Common Myths and Misconceptions

The weight loss journey is often clouded by myths that can lead to frustration and confusion. Here are some misconceptions to be aware of:

  • Myth: All calories are equal. Fact: The source of calories matters and can affect metabolism and hunger.
  • Myth: Skipping meals aids weight loss. Fact: This often leads to overeating later and can disrupt metabolism.
  • Myth: Carbs are the enemy. Fact: Whole carbohydrates can be beneficial as part of a balanced diet.
  • Myth: You must exercise for hours daily. Fact: Short, intense workouts can also yield positive results.

FAQs

What is the best diet for weight loss?

A balanced diet focusing on whole foods, lean proteins, healthy fats, and plenty of fruits and vegetables is generally effective.

How much exercise do I need to lose weight?

Strive for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ity per week, supplemented by strength training.

Can I lose weight without changing my diet?

While exercise can aid weight loss, combining dietary changes with physical activity is crucial for sustaining results.

How quickly can I expect to lose weight?

Safe and sustainable weight loss typically ranges from 1-2 pounds per week.

Are all exercise types equal for weight loss?

No, varying your workouts by including both cardiovascular and strength training can enhance results.

How important is hydration in weight loss?

Hydration is vital as it can suppress appetite, enhance digestion, and boost metabolism.
